About

Stefania Matteoli is a scholar working on Media Technology, Aerospace Engineering and Analytical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Stefania Matteoli has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Media Technology, 20 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 13 papers in Analytical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Stefania Matteoli’s work include Remote-Sensing Image Classification (31 papers),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(13 papers) and Infrared Target Detection Methodologies (13 papers). Stefania Matteoli is often cited by papers focused on Remote-Sensing Image Classification (31 papers),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(13 papers) and Infrared Target Detection Methodologies (13 papers). Stefania Matteoli coll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and The Netherlands. Stefania Matteoli's co-authors include Marco Diani, Giovanni Corsini, James Theiler, Nicola Acito, Amanda Ziemann, Emmett J. Ientilucci, John P. Kerekes, Damiano Remorini, Pietro Bolli and Giuseppe Addamo and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, IEEE Transactions on Geoscience and Remote Sensing and IEEE Transactions on Antennas and Propagation.
